New Zealand v Sri Lanka, 1st Test, Day 4 - New Zealand are on top, but Sri Lanka are fighting


Sri Lanka need 405 runs to win the first Test against New Zealand. It is not an easy target for this young Sri Lankan side to chase in five sessions and what the Lankans needed was resistance to ensure a respectable draw. Their young openers were impressive and made the Kiwi pace attack to work for their wickets.

But just as stability was about to take a permanent place on a stop-start-day due to inclement weather, Dimuth Karunaratne and Kusal Medis were dismissed and the early departure of Udara Jayasudera led to the entry of Angelow Mathews and Dinesh Chandimal​ - the two most senior players in the side on whom a lot of things will depend.

Angelo Mathews​ must lead from the front and Chandimal must control his extravagant stroke-making instincts and support his captain for a brief period so that the value of a hard fought draw sustains in Test cricket. As usual the first session will be crucial tomorrow.
